Is it possible to get the time, not only the date, of missed calls made more than 1 day ago? |

Pinpoint,
It's possible..you have to change date(back) in your phone to wanted time point. And you will see exact time:-)

Yep. Reset your date on the phone to the day you got the missed call. That will show you the time of missed call on that day as well.  |
